IoT Solutions for Real-Time Monitoring and Predictive Maintenance

The Internet of Things (IoT) has quickly become a part of industry because it can connect devices and collect real time data efficiently for analysis purposes. A major technological breakthrough is its use, in real time monitoring and predictive maintenance tasks that are revolutionizing industries by minimizing downtime and operational costs while improving performance efficiency. Companies can use technology to monitor machinery and systems in time and proactively address maintenance needs by analyzing data to predict maintenance requirements before problems occur.   

The Internet of Things (IoT) is transforming sectors such as manufacturing and transportation by enhancing efficiency and providing businesses with an edge.  

Advantages of Real-Time Monitoring

Real time monitoring is a standout application of technology, in settings where sensors are used to continuously monitor the operation and status of machinery and infrastructure such as vehicles.The sensors collect data including temperature and pressure readings, vibrations and energy consumption patterns before transmitting this information to cloud platforms or centralized systems for analysis.

Shifting attention to maintenance of reactive repairs 

Spotting issues in time is beneficial because it allows for action when problems arise. On the maintenance takes a proactive approach to maintenance tasks by using IoT data alongside advanced analytics and machine learning algorithms to predict potential machinery or equipment failures beforehand.These systems examine performance data trends to identify signs of wear and tear or other issues before they become problems.  

For example a machine might show signs of decreased efficiency such as increases in vibrations or changes in power usage that may not be noticed by operators eyesight alone. Predictive maintenance systems can pick up these trends. Predict when the machine will need maintenance work done so that maintenance activities can be planned at the time which often align with scheduled breaks. This aids in avoiding disruptions caused by breakdowns or emergency repairs.  

By addressing maintenance needs before problems arise companies can reduce costs and increase the lifespan of equipment while improving overall efficiency as well.Predictive maintenance also reduces the need for inspections or scheduled maintenance that may be unnecessary when the machinery is functioning optimally.  

Sectors that benefit from the Internet of Things in maintenance

In sectors such as manufacturing and other industries there are benefits to utilizing IoT solutions and services for real time monitoring and predictive maintenance activities as seen in the manufacturing sector where factories rely heavily on machinery that can result in repairs and reduced productivity if they malfunction abruptly. By incorporating sensors, throughout the production lines to monitor the health of machines effectively enables manufacturers to prevent breakdowns and ensure production processes.  

Firms that oversee vehicle fleets in the industry utilize technology to keep tabs on vehicle conditions in time by using sensors installed in trucks and cars to monitor engine health and tire pressure while also tracking fuel consumption levels simultaneously. Cutting edge maintenance notifications assist fleet managers in arranging servicing to minimize disruptions and ensure that vehicles remain operational smoothly on the roads.  

The energy production sector and the oil and gas industry both see advantages in utilizing technology for monitoring and maintenance purposes too. For sites such as power plants or offshore drilling platforms where any disruption could result in losses. Having access to updates on equipment status proves crucial. IoT monitoring devices play a role in detecting issues with turbines, generators or pipelines and notifying operators beforehand. Through the use of analytics these functions can be enhanced more by guaranteeing replacement or maintenance of parts before they break down thereby enhancing operational efficiency and safety protocols.  

Ways to Manage Internet of Things Operational Systems

Using technology, for real time monitoring and predictive maintenance offers advantages. Also comes with its share of challenges during implementation. Dealing with the amount of data generated by devices can be overwhelming requiring infrastructure and advanced analytical tools to manage it effectively. Moreover integrating systems with legacy equipment in environments not originally designed for progress can pose significant hurdles.  

The methods for overcoming these challenges are evolving rapidly in todays paced environment.. For example cloud based services provide infrastructure to handle amounts of data effectively.. Additionally these services offer sophisticated analysis capabilities, for processing real time data streams and enabling modeling tasks for companies lacking expertise in this field.. 

Security presents a challenge in this situation as it is essential to protect both the hardware and data when multiple devices connect to a network. Implementing encryption techniques and secure communication protocols along with device updates can mitigate risks associated with adopting IoT technology.
